Abstract
The use of an integrated approach to the analysis of the construction of existing information systems, including not only mathematical and algorithmic, but also ontological, epistemological components, makes it possible to consider many familiar issues from a slightly different point of view. If the main criterion for the construction of a network-type information system is the time spent by radar information in the information system, and the goal is to minimize it, then the limitations introduced in the development of the traditional algorithm for tertiary processing of radar information become clear. Attempts to apply the algorithm developed for different from modern conditions and requirements lead to contradictions in the construction of information systems. The list of requirements for promising information systems obtained on the basis of the analysis of traditional tertiary processing allows us to consider the main problems of information processing and delivery from a slightly different point of view and, thus, prepare the basis for building promising information systems of a network structure.
